Baylor School is a premier co-educational college preparatory school serving the greater Chattanooga area, including Sale Creek. Founded in 1893, Baylor offers a rigorous academic program with 24 Advanced Placement courses, extensive STEM offerings, and comprehensive arts and athletics programs. The 690-acre campus features state-of-the-art facilities including science laboratories, performing arts centers, and athletic complexes. With a student-teacher ratio of 9:1, Baylor provides personalized attention and has a strong track record of college placements at top universities nationwide.

What are the primary private school options available for families residing in Sale Creek, Tennessee?

While Sale Creek itself is a smaller community, families typically look to nearby Chattanooga for the most prominent private school options. The most notable include Baylor School (co-ed, day and boarding), Girls Preparatory School (all-girls, day), and Silverdale Baptist Academy (co-ed, Christian). These schools are all within a 20-30 minute commute from Sale Creek. There are also smaller parochial and independent schools in the greater Chattanooga area. Due to Sale Creek's rural setting, private schooling involves planning for transportation to these neighboring cities.

How does tuition at top Chattanooga-area private schools compare, and are there Tennessee-specific financial aid options for Sale Creek residents?

Tuition for the leading schools near Sale Creek varies. For the 2024-2025 academic year, Baylor and GPS tuition ranges from approximately $30,000 to $35,000 for day students, while Silverdale Baptist Academy is typically lower, often between $10,000 and $15,000. Tennessee offers specific financial aid programs that Sale Creek residents can utilize, most notably the Education Savings Account (ESA) program, which provides state funds for eligible students to attend private schools. Additionally, many schools offer substantial need-based financial aid and merit scholarships. It's crucial to apply for aid directly through each school's financial aid office.

What unique academic or extracurricular programs do private schools near Sale Creek offer that leverage the Tennessee region?

Schools in the Chattanooga area capitalize on the local geography and economy. Baylor School, located on the Tennessee River, has a renowned rowing program and extensive outdoor education. Girls Preparatory School offers strong STEM initiatives with local partnerships, including with the Tennessee Aquarium and UTC. Silverdale Baptist Academy integrates Christian worldview across its curriculum. All these schools may offer unique travel, study, and service opportunities within the Appalachian region and the Southeast, differentiating them from more generic private school programs.

What is the typical enrollment timeline and process for competitive private schools like Baylor, GPS, and Silverdale for a family moving to Sale Creek?

The process is highly structured and begins early. For fall admission, applications for schools like Baylor and GPS typically open in August/September, with deadlines between January and February. The process includes standardized testing (ISEE/SSAT), school visits, interviews, and teacher recommendations. Silverdale Baptist Academy may have a slightly more flexible timeline but still encourages early application. As a Sale Creek resident, it's vital to initiate contact with admissions offices 12-18 months in advance, especially for competitive entry grades, to understand transportation logistics and ensure placement.

For a family in rural Sale Creek, what are the key considerations when comparing the local public school (Sale Creek School, a K-12 public school) to private options in Chattanooga?

The decision hinges on several location-specific factors. Sale Creek School offers the convenience of a close-knit, community-based K-12 education with no tuition or lengthy commute. In contrast, private schools in Chattanooga offer broader academic choices (e.g., AP/IB curricula), specialized facilities, and different social environments, but require a significant daily commute (30+ minutes each way) and major financial investment. Parents must weigh the value of a rural community school experience against the expanded resources, college preparatory focus, and specific religious or pedagogical approaches of private institutions. Visiting both the local public school and the private options is essential to feel the difference in environment.
